Essential Visit Information

  • Operating Hours: Daily from 10:00 AM to 10:00 PM
  • Location: Párisi Udvar, Budapest city center
  • Duration: Plan for 1-2 hours to fully immerse yourself

Ticket Prices:

  • Full price: 6,700 HUF (online or on-site)
  • Student/Senior: 5,000 HUF (with valid photo ID)
  • Children (3-12 years): 4,000 HUF
  • Group bookings (10+ people): 50,000 HUF

What Makes This Experience So Special?

Cinema Mystica isn’t your typical museum where you quietly observe art from behind velvet ropes. This is a 1,200-square-meter playground where you become part of the artwork itself. The current exhibition, “Form in Flux – Patterns of Consciousness,” takes you on a sensory journey exploring the intelligent patterns hidden within forms and the cosmic order behind life itself.

The experience features 21 digital artworks spread across 10 rooms, powered by over 100 projectors and created by 26 talented artists. You’ll walk through installations like “The Cleansing,” the “Solfeggio Room,” and “Morphogenesis” – each designed to blur the boundaries between vision and reality.

What to Expect Inside

The moment you step inside, you’re transported into what feels like a lucid dream. The exhibition explores whether forms in nature might be manifestations of conscious principles rather than random occurrences. Through generative visual art, light installations, sound design, and interactive spaces, you’ll experience a world where the boundaries between human and artwork dissolve.

Each room offers a different sensory adventure. Some visitors describe feeling completely relaxed and enveloped by the audiovisual experience, while others are amazed by the AI-powered interactive elements that let you create your own avatar. The beauty lies in how personal the experience becomes – no two visits are exactly alike.
